
It’s attainable to breathe in microplastics.
A examine accepted for publication in Science of the Whole Surroundings final month detected microplastics within the lung tissue of residing folks for the primary time, and far deeper than the researchers anticipated.
“We didn’t look forward to finding the very best variety of particles within the decrease areas of the lungs, or particles of the sizes we discovered,” senior creator Laura Sadofsky at Hull York medical faculty instructed The Guardian. “It’s stunning because the airways are smaller within the decrease elements of the lungs and we might have anticipated particles of those sizes to be filtered out or trapped earlier than getting this deep.”
The analysis comes as an increasing number of proof reveals that microplastics are penetrating the human physique. One other examine printed days earlier discovered microplastics in human blood for the primary time, and in virtually 80 % of the folks sampled.
The brand new examine additionally discovered the plastic within the majority of lung tissue samples – 11 out of 13, the examine authors wrote. A complete of 39 microplastics have been present in all areas of the lung.
Earlier research had discovered plastics in lung samples taken from autopsies. One 2021 examine in Brazil discovered microplastics within the lungs of 13 out of 20 folks studied, The Guardian reported. A 1998 examine of U.S. lung most cancers sufferers discovered plastic and plant fibers in additional than 100 samples. Nonetheless, the lung tissue in the latest examine got here from dwell sufferers at Citadel Hill Hospital in East Yorkshire, the Press Affiliation reported. It was eliminated in surgical procedures as a part of the sufferers’ routine medical care.
“Microplastics have beforehand been present in human cadaver post-mortem samples; that is the primary strong examine to point out microplastics in lungs from dwell folks,” Sadofsky stated, because the Press Affiliation reported.
The scientists used spectrometry to determine the plastics, The Guardian defined. The most typical two varieties of plastic have been polypropylene, which is used for packaging and pipes, and PET, which is often used for beverage bottles.
In complete, 11 microplastics have been discovered within the higher elements of the lung, seven within the center and 21 within the decrease elements, a consequence that was notably stunning, in line with the Press Affiliation.
“Lung airways are very slender so no-one thought they might probably get there, however they clearly have,” Sadofsky stated, because the Press Affiliation reported.
The findings construct on studies that folks uncovered to microplastics in industrial settings have developed respiratory signs and ailments, the examine authors wrote.
“This knowledge supplies an vital advance within the area of air air pollution, microplastics and human well being,” Sadofsky stated, because the Press Affiliation reported. “The characterisation of varieties and ranges of microplastics now we have discovered can now inform real looking circumstances for laboratory publicity experiments with the purpose of figuring out well being impacts.”
